Job Description

IN A NUTSHELL

As a Social Media Specialist for Surf & Skate, you’ll lead social media strategy, develop content from idea to release, and work with international teams to grow engaged communities across platforms through creative, data-driven storytelling.

LEAD RED BULL SURF AND SKATE SOCIAL MEDIA STRATEGY

In this role, you’ll build and implement social media plans for Red Bull Surf and Skate across all relevant platforms. You’ll manage content calendars across channels and projects, ensure a consistent and engaging presence, and bring Red Bull’s loving life approach and tone of voice to life through compelling content. At the same time, you’ll help build, nurture, and grow a strong community of Red Bull brand and can lovers.

CONTENT IDEATION, PRODUCTION AND RELEASE

You’ll develop efficient workflows that take social concepts from ideation through production and all the way to release. Working closely with internal video editors and production management, you’ll help turn creative ideas into impactful social content that resonates with surf and skate audiences.

CONTENT ANALYSIS

Using Red Bull’s suite of analytical tools, you’ll monitor and evaluate content performance across platforms. You’ll turn data into meaningful insights and actionable recommendations, helping to educate global and local teams on best practices and drive stronger surf and skate content performance.

PROGRAMMING

You’ll work closely with international teams to program always-on content across our managed platforms, including Instagram, TikTok, YouTube Shorts, and Facebook. By adapting content output to the strengths of each channel, you’ll help maximize performance on every post. You’ll also optimize channel performance through analytics, scheduling, featuring, customized platform functionalities, and by creating smooth consumer journeys across platforms.

 

Qualifications

  • 3+ years of experience in a social media role, ideally within a major brand, media company, or culture-driven environment, with the ability to work autonomously and manage several projects simultaneously
  • Strong passion for surf and/or skate culture, with a solid understanding of the communities, aesthetics, and trends shaping both scenes
  • Proven ability to develop creative social-first ideas and manage content workflows from planning through execution, combined with a strong analytical mindset, a curiosity to learn and grow, and the ability to translate performance data into actionable recommendations
  •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and collaboration skills, with a strong team player mentality and experience working across international and cross-functional teams; fluent in English, additional languages are a plus
  • Familiarity with social platforms such as Instagram, TikTok, YouTube Shorts, and Facebook, including platform-specific best practices
  • Experience with tools such as MS Office and Airtable; video editing skills are a plus
